Minister of Treasury and Finance Mehmet Şimşek stated that there is only one legal regulation regarding crypto assets left for Turkey to be removed from the gray list, and that they will present it to the Parliament in a short time.

Two years ago, the Financial Action Task Force (FATF) of the Organization for Economic Co-operation and Development (OECD) placed Turkey on the gray list, which requires stricter monitoring, because it "has deficiencies in preventing money laundering and the financing of terrorism".

Minister Şimşek answered the questions of the MPs during the discussions of the 2024 budget of his ministry at the Grand National Assembly of Turkey Plan Budget Commission.

Şimşek stated that FATF recently concluded that Turkey did not meet only one of the 40 criteria determined by the institution:

"We are doing whatever is necessary. A meeting was held within the FATF on October 27. It was underlined that there was only one item left in the action plan envisaged for our country to be removed from the gray list. I also told you about that issue; the legal regulation regarding crypto assets. I hope that as soon as possible on this issue." "We will submit the regulation to our Parliament. If there are no other political considerations, there will be no reason for our country to remain on the gray list within this framework."
